Homebrew Zombie Species Details

From somewhere in the darkness, a gurgling moan is heard. A form lurches into view, dragging one foot as it raises bloated arms and broken hands. The zombie advances, driven to kill anyone too slow to escape its grasp.

Dark Servants

Sinister necromantic magic infuses the remains of the dead, causing them to rise as zombies that do their creator's bidding without fear or hesitation. They move with a jerky, uneven gait, clad in the moldering apparel they wore when put to rest, and carrying the stench of decay. Most zombies are made from humanoid remains, though the flesh and bones of any formerly living creature can be imbued with a semblance of life. Necromantic magic, usually from spells, animates a zombie. Some zombies rise spontaneously when dark magic saturates an area. Once turned into a zombie, a creature can't be restored to life except by powerful magic, such as a resurrection spell.

Hideous Forms

Zombies appear as they did in life, showing the wounds that killed them. However, the magic that creates these vile creatures often takes time to run its course. Dead warriors might rise from a battlefield, eviscerated and bloated after days in the sun. The muddy cadaver of a peasant could claw its way from the ground, riddled with maggots and worms. A zombie might wash ashore or rise from a marsh, swollen and reeking after weeks in the water.

Zombie Traits

Zombies are slow, but are very resilient.

Creature Type

You are an Undead.

Size

Different living races vary widely in height and build, from less than feet to well over 6 feet tall. You are either Medium or Small (choose one when you select this race).

Speed

Your base walking speed is 20 feet.

Languages

You can speak, read, and write Common, Deep Speech, and one extra language of your choice that you knew in life.

Age

No matter your age when you died, you will live forever (until killed) as a zombie. You do not age as an undead.

Ability Score Increase

Your Constitution score increases by 2, and your Strength score increases by 1.

Undead Fortitude

If damage reduces you to 0 hit points, you must make a Constitution saving throw with a DC of 5 + the damage taken, unless the damage is radiant or from a critical hit. On a success, you drops to 1 hit point instead.

Poison Immunity

You are immune to poison damage and the poisoned condition.

Turn Resistance

You have advantage on saving throws against any effect that turns undead.

Magic Resistance

You have advantage on saving throws against spells and other magical effects.

Undead Nature

You don’t require air, food, drink, or sleep. You can finish a Short or Long Rest in half the time, spending those hours standing in a trancelike stillness, during which you retain consciousness.
